Brick Repair in White County, GA
Brick rep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of brickwork on residential properties. These projects typically include fixing cracked or crumbling bricks, replacing damaged or missing units, and addressing issues caused by weathering or settling. Homeowners often seek brick repair to improve curb appeal, prevent further deterioration, and ensure the safety of exterior walls, chimneys, fireplaces, or other brick features.
Before requesting brick repair, property owners should consider the extent of damage, the age of the brickwork, and whether the repairs involve matching existing bricks or materials. Understanding the scope of the project helps in planning repairs that blend seamlessly with the existing structure. It’s also useful to know if the work will include repointing mortar joints or addressing underlying issues such as moisture infiltration, which can contribute to ongoing deterioration.

Common Brick Repair Jobs
Brick Crack Repair - filling and sealing c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Repointing - replacing deteriorated mortar between bricks to restore stability and appearance.
Brick Replacement - removing damaged or crumbling bricks and installing new ones to match existing work.
Efflorescence Removal - cleaning mineral deposits to improve brick surface and prevent staining.
Brick Cleaning - pressure washing or chemical cleaning to restore brickwork’s original look.
Structural Reinforcement - adding supports or ties to stabilize leaning or bowing brick walls.
Brick Repair Questions
What types of brick damage can be repaired? Common issues like cracks, chips, and mortar deterioration can be addressed through repair services.
How are brick repairs typically performed? Repairs often involve replacing damaged bricks, repointing mortar joints, or patching surface cracks for a seamless look.
Is brick repair suitable for historic or decorative brickwork? Yes, repairs can be carefully matched to preserve the appearance and integrity of historic or decorative bricks.
What property features commonly require brick repair? Brick repair is often needed for chimneys, exterior walls, foundations, and walkways showing signs of damage or wear.
